Alex bikes to work and then back home four days a week, which is 65 miles total each week. How many kilometers does he bike each day that he bikes to work? Round your answer to the nearest tenth of a kilometer if needed. (Hint: 1 mi ≈ 1.609 km)

A: 40.4 km

B: 26.1 km

C: 61.6 km

D: 104.6 km

Explanation:

First, we can convert the total distance Alex bikes each week from miles to kilometers. Since 1 mile is approximately equal to 1.609 kilometers, 65 miles is approximately equal to 65 * 1.609 = 104.585 kilometers.

Since Alex bikes to work and back home four days a week, he bikes a total of 104.585 kilometers / 4 = 26.14625 kilometers each day that he bikes to work.

Rounded to the nearest tenth of a kilometer, Alex bikes approximately 26.1 kilometers each day that he bikes to work. So the correct answer is B: 26.1 km.
